Offshore seismic survey firm PXGEO said Wednesday it had secured work with oil major Shell.

The company said it had secured a vessel commitment from Shell to provide 12 months of high-end marine towed streamer seismic acquisition services.

PXGEO will be providing the services over a two-year period. 

The company did not share details on the potential locations of the projects.
